Primeiro mês de aula e cá estamos com nossa primeira atividade avaliativa. A atividade consta na construçao de um menu de opções para prepararmos nosso ambiente para ordenar um vetor de N posições usando os algoritmos de ordenaçao de Inserção e Bolha. Além disso, temos como tarefa medir o tempo de execução desses algoritmos, e produzir uma análise de qual dos dois algoritmos testados é mais eficiente. Então os passos são os seguintes:
01 - Fazer um menu que possua as seguintes opções:
Menu de opções
01 - Preencher vetor de 500 posições com 500 elementos aleatórios;
02 - Ordenar e imprimir o vetor com o metodo da Bolha;
03 - Ordenar e imprimir o vetor com o método de Inserção;
04 - Comparar e imprimir tempo de execução dos dois métodos;
05 - Sair.
Opção: [ ]
Requisitos do programa:
a) Criar função para ordenação e impressão no método bolha e inserção;
–> funcao ordenaBolha e funcao ordenaInsercao
b) Usar a funçao clock() do c++ para medir o tempo de execução do programa;
c) Criar função para preencher o vetor de 500 posiçoes.
–> Usar a funçao rand() do c++ para preenchimento aleatório.